export default function StatCard({ icon: Icon, label, value, subtitle, color = 'brand-primary', trend }) { const accentMap = { 'brand-primary': 'accent-primary', 'brand-secondary': 'accent-secondary', 'brand-tertiary': 'accent-tertiary', 'brand-quaternary': 'accent-quaternary', } const iconBgMap = { 'brand-primary': 'bg-indigo-50 text-indigo-600 shadow-lg shadow-indigo-500/20', 'brand-secondary': 'bg-pink-50 text-pink-600 shadow-lg shadow-pink-500/20', 'brand-tertiary': 'bg-amber-50 text-amber-600 shadow-lg shadow-amber-500/20', 'brand-quaternary': 'bg-emerald-50 text-emerald-600 shadow-lg shadow-emerald-500/20', } const accentClass = accentMap[color] || 'accent-primary' return (

{label}

{value}

{subtitle && (

{subtitle}

)}
{trend && (
0 ? 'text-emerald-600' : 'text-red-500'}`}> {trend > 0 ? '+' : ''}{trend}% vs last month
)}
) }